A photocell is illuminated by a small bright source placed 1 m away. When the same source of light is placed 1 2 m away, the number of electrons emitted by photocathode would
Options
- Adecrease by a factor of 2
- Bincrease by a factor of 2
- Cdecrease by a factor of 4
- Dincrease by a factor of 4
Correct answer
D. increase by a factor of 4
Step-by-step solution
I = P of source 4 π distance 2 = P 4 π d 2 Here, we assume light to spread uniformly in all directions. The number of photo-electrons emitted from a surface depends on the intensity of light I falling on it. Thus the number of electrons emitted n depends directly on I . P remains constant as the source is the same. ∴ I 2 I 1 = n 2 n 1 ⇒ P 2 P 1 ( d 1 d 2 ) 2 = n 2 n 1 ∴ n 2 n 1 = P P 1 1 2 2 = 4 1 ( ∵   P 1   = P 2   = P )
